Are Convection Vapes Healthier?

Are Convection Vapes Healthier?

If you’re a fan of vaping, you may have heard of convection vapes. They’re becoming increasingly popular, and for good reason. Unlike conduction vapes, which heat up the herb by direct contact with a heating element, convection vapes use hot air to heat the herb. This means that the herb is heated more evenly and doesn’t come into contact with any hot metal or plastic, which could potentially release harmful chemicals.

But the question remains: are convection vapes healthier than their conduction counterparts? While there isn’t a definitive answer, many experts believe that convection vapes are indeed a healthier option. Because the herb is heated more evenly, there’s less chance of it burning and releasing harmful chemicals. Additionally, because there’s no direct contact with a heating element, there’s less chance of any harmful chemicals being released from the vape itself.

Of course, it’s important to note that vaping in general is still a relatively new phenomenon, and there’s still much research to be done on the long-term health effects. However, if you’re looking for a potentially healthier vaping option, a convection vape may be the way to go.

What Are Convection Vapes?

If you’re new to vaping, you might be wondering what exactly a convection vape is. Simply put, a convection vape heats your herb by blowing hot air over it. This is in contrast to a conduction vape, which heats your herb by direct contact with a heating element.

Convection vapes tend to be more expensive than conduction vapes, but they have some advantages. For one, they tend to produce smoother hits because the hot air evenly heats the herb. This can also lead to more efficient use of your herb, as it is heated more evenly and thoroughly.

Another advantage of convection vapes is that they are generally considered to be healthier than conduction vapes. This is because conduction vapes can sometimes produce smoke or combustion, which can release harmful chemicals into your lungs. Convection vapes, on the other hand, are less likely to produce smoke or combustion, which can make them a safer choice for your health.

Overall, convection vapes are a great choice for anyone looking for a high-quality vaping experience. They may be more expensive than conduction vapes, but they offer a number of advantages that make them worth the investment.

Health Implications of Convection Vapes

When it comes to consuming medical marijuana, inhaling it through smoking is a popular method, but it poses health risks. Convection vapes, on the other hand, use a heating method that doesn’t involve combustion, which means fewer harmful chemicals are produced. Here’s a closer look at the health implications of using convection vapes.

Comparison with Traditional Smoking

Compared to smoking, convection vapes are a healthier option because they don’t produce tar and other harmful chemicals that can damage your lungs. Instead, they heat up the cannabis to a temperature that releases the active ingredients into vapor. This means you can enjoy the benefits of medical marijuana without the harmful side effects of smoking.

Impact on Lung Health

One of the biggest concerns with smoking cannabis is that it can lead to respiratory problems. Smoking can irritate the lungs and cause inflammation, which can make it difficult to breathe. Convection vapes, on the other hand, don’t produce smoke, so they’re less harmful to your lungs. By using a convection vape, you can avoid the negative impact that smoking can have on your respiratory system.

Effect on Oral Health

Smoking cannabis can also have a negative impact on your oral health. It can cause bad breath, stained teeth, and gum disease. Convection vapes don’t produce smoke, which means they don’t have the same impact on your oral health. By using a convection vape, you can avoid the negative impact that smoking can have on your teeth and gums.

Overall, convection vapes are a healthier option for consuming medical marijuana. They offer the benefits of cannabis without the harmful side effects of smoking. By using a convection vape, you can enjoy the benefits of medical marijuana while protecting your lungs and oral health.

Reduced Toxins

One of the main benefits of convection vapes is that they are believed to produce fewer toxins than conduction vapes. This is because convection vapes heat the air around the herb, which then passes through the herb and vaporizes the cannabinoids and terpenes. In contrast, conduction vapes heat the herb directly, which can cause combustion and the release of harmful chemicals.

Temperature Control

Another benefit of convection vapes is that they offer better temperature control. Convection vapes typically have more precise temperature controls than conduction vapes, which allows you to customize your vaping experience. You can adjust the temperature to get the most out of your herb, whether you want a mild or strong effect.

In conclusion, convection vapes are believed to offer several benefits over conduction vapes. They are believed to produce fewer toxins and offer better temperature control. If you are looking for a healthier and more customizable vaping experience, a convection vape may be the way to go.
